Naxos Town

Naxos, commonly referred to as Chora, is a city and a former municipality on the island of Naxos, in the Cyclades, Greece. The community has 8,897 inhabitants. It is located on the west side of Naxos Island in the Cyclades island group in the Aegean. Wikipedia.

Naxos, also known as Chora in Greek, is a city and the capital of the island of Naxos in the Cyclades, Greece. It serves as a transport hub and offers various tourist amenities such as hotels, restaurants, bars, and shops. The town's snow-white old quarter with the iconic temple gate Portara and Venetian fortress is a must-visit attraction.

Naxos, the largest of the Cyclades islands, is a treasure trove of history and natural beauty. The island boasts seven museums showcasing artifacts from various periods, including the Archaeological Museum with exhibits dating back to the Neolithic period. Visitors can explore ancient ruins like the doorlike remains of the Temple of Apollo and wander through Chora's Venetian castle.

Agios Prokopios is a charming seaside village located on the island of Naxos, Greece. It is renowned for its stunning beaches along the Aegean Sea, making it a beloved destination for tourists. With a population of 222 residents, this coastal town offers all the comforts of a dedicated beach vacation spot while being conveniently close to Naxos Town and the airport. The area caters largely to foreign visitors but still retains its authentic Greek culture with numerous tavernas and traditional restaurants.

The Venetian Castle of Naxos is a remarkable edifice with thick walls made of large rocks, showcasing traditional medieval architecture. The narrow streets are now lined with shops and Greek tavernas offering exceptional local produce and meats. Visitors can explore the Mycenaean City of Grotta, various museums, the Catholic Church, and the Central Tower within the Chora and main square.

Barozzi Naxos Restaurant is a farm-to-table dining spot in Naxos town, offering a fine-dining experience with a focus on Naxian cuisine and local ingredients. The menu, designed by acclaimed Greek chef Gikas Xenakis and executed by chef Kostas Votanos, has received the Aegean Cuisine certificate and various distinctions. Housed in a renovated 1930s building, the restaurant provides an upscale option for gourmet enthusiasts.

Typografio Restaurant, nestled in the heart of Naxos' old town, offers a delightful dining experience with its charming terrace and courtyard providing scenic views of the castle and old town. This restaurant specializes in modern Greek cuisine, using local Naxian products to create dishes that beautifully blend tradition with contemporary flair. Housed in a former newspaper press at the base of one of Naxos' castles, Typografio boasts an inviting atmosphere and professional staff ready to assist.
